Inmates at risk over doctors’ strike

DIABETIC prisoners or those on a methadone programme are among new inmates that could be put at risk by a planned prison doctors’ strike.

The State’s 25 prison doctors, most of whom are part-time, have given notice that they will withdraw services from next Tuesday.

A meeting on Thursday between doctors’ representatives and Prison Service director general Seán Aylward failed to head off the strike action. While an emergency service has been offered, prison management has to provide for normal day-to-day cover, said the Irish Medical Organisation, which claims the Department of Finance is refusing to release cash to satisfy the doctors’ demands.
